Andhra Pradesh: Two killed over financial dispute in Kakinada

Two people were killed and one survived an attempted murder in Tatiparthi village, Kakinada, after a money-related fight. The accused, a relative, allegedly pushed them into a well. Police are investigating and have registered a case under BNS sections

Gollaprolu (Andhra Pradesh): Two persons were killed and another survived an attempted murder following a financial dispute in Tatiparthi village of Kakinada district, a police official said on Thursday.

District Superintendent of Police (SP) G Bindu Madhav said that the accused, Rampam Gangadhar, allegedly lured his relatives, Rampam Srinivas (51) and Thorati Suribabu (44), to a field late on Tuesday and killed them by pushing them into a well.


“Two persons were murdered and one person (Suribabu) escaped an attempt on his life in Tatiparthi village over a financial dispute,” Madhav told PTI. The bodies of Srinivas and Suribabu were shifted to Pithapuram Community Health Centre (PCHC) for postmortem after conducting inquest proceedings.

Police have registered a case under section 103(1), 109(1) BNS. Suspects are being interrogated and further investigation is underway, the SP added.
